Flow measurement is one of the most important measurement items in the field of industrial measurement. When measuring the flow rate of fluids (liquids and gases), a method that utilizes the pressure difference before and after a restriction mechanism, such as an orifice, flow nozzle, venturi, or pitot tube, installed in the pipeline through which the fluid flows, is most commonly used in industrial measurement and its automatic control. Accurate and reliable flow measurement leads to effective plant operation, efficient energy use, environmental conservation, improved safety, and overall cost reduction. Pitot tube flow meter

basic information

The "polynomial Pitot tube" or "Barflow tube" is not a throttling structure like an orifice or venturi, allowing for very low permanent pressure loss. It is equipped with multiple total pressure measurement ports and static pressure measurement ports, enabling the measurement of the average flow velocity in the piping and detecting stable flow rates. To prevent clogging of the measurement ports, which is the biggest weakness of Pitot tubes, the Pitot tube sensor is continuously purged during measurement.

Applications/Examples of results

The "polynomial Pitot tube" Barflow tube allows for flow rate and velocity measurements with low pressure loss. Therefore, it is widely used for exhaust gas measurements in factories and plants where energy conservation is desired. It has many applications in waste treatment facilities, sewage treatment plants, steelworks, chemical plants, and more.
